Inductance
120 µH

CC453232-121KL has an inductance value of 120 µH. This value indicates how much magnetic energy the component can store and is one of the first parameters to compare when selecting an inductor.

Current Rating
160 mA

CC453232-121KL is rated for 160 mA. Current rating helps determine whether the part can carry the expected DC or RMS current without excessive heating or saturation risk.

DC Resistance (DCR)
4.5Ohm Max

CC453232-121KL lists a DC resistance of 4.5Ohm Max. Lower DCR usually reduces conduction loss and improves efficiency in power circuits.

Package / Case
1812 (4532 Metric)

CC453232-121KL uses a package or case of 1812 (4532 Metric). Package size affects PCB footprint, height clearance, thermal behavior, and compatibility with automated assembly.
